Transaction 0876c5ccae810568b376aee3791038df749ed438fba8d57ae91edbeffffa9d0e
1 Input
2 Outputs
- 0876c5ccae810568b376aee3791038df749ed438fba8d57ae91edbeffffa9d0e:0
- 0876c5ccae810568b376aee3791038df749ed438fba8d57ae91edbeffffa9d0e:1
value 779399529
address 1DrMHMFPwYfkpmcavsVXT3rUJ53hZetXg2
value 4400051
address 12Hqq22VQQsr9nkVBcmJ9PEQcaKAs25mpd